What does black seed cure?

Today, black seed is used for treating digestive tract conditions including gas, colic, diarrhea, dysentery, constipation, and hemorrhoids. It is also used for respiratory conditions including asthma, allergies, cough, bronchitis, emphysema, flu, swine flu, and congestion.

What are the side effects of kalonji seeds?

Black seed can cause allergic rashes in some people. It can also cause stomach upset, vomiting, or constipation. When applied to the skin: Black seed oil or gel is POSSIBLY SAFE when applied to the skin, short-term. It can cause allergic rashes in some people.

What kind of plant is Nigella sativa black seed?

Kalonji, also known as Nigella sativa, black seed, and black cumin, is a flowering plant native to Southern Europe, North Africa, and Southwest Asia. Its seeds have long been used in herbal medicine to treat a variety of diseases and conditions ranging from diabetes to arthritis ( 1 ).

Can a black seed diet help you lose weight?

As far as weight loss is concerned, the review notes that some randomized controlled trials do indicate that, when black seed is incorporated as part of a low-calorie diet, it can be helpful in promoting weight loss among people with obesity.
